The Elves witnessed it all.

The sight of nature in its purest form was burned into their minds.

They saw how Monsters devoured fellow Monsters, and how cruel the entire process could be. The world within the Dungeon was unforgiving—certainly not for the faint of heart or weak in spirit.

It was a complete nightmare.

Rey took them through paths, traversing various Floors so they could see even more of the calamity occur right before their eyes.

Some of them protested, desiring more than anything to leave the horrid place, but they were all ignored.

"You can leave if you want." They were told, but none of them dared to step a foot outside the only shroud of protection that they currently had.

They also couldn't attack Rey. If they did, and the barrier collapsed, they were pretty much done for too. As a result, they all followed him obediently—like sheep in a herd.

Finally, after reaching the entrance to the Bottom Floor of the Dungeon, they finally halted their long and frightening journey.

"C-can we go back now?"

"I'm so tired… and hungry…"

"My legs hurt. This place stinks. I want to go home."

Rey tuned out their whinings and focused on the door that stood in front of him. It was a double door, one he had to push from both sides to open. The thick stony surface showed just how strong of a barrier it was—and how heavy the doors were.
